Floral Friday #83: December 23, 2022
Spotted this plant by the checkout counter at our local Aldi’s. The Kalanchoe is a group of exotic succulents prized for their unusual foliage and flowers. The scientific name is Kalanchoe blossfeldiana. It is a herbaceous and is commonly cultivated as a house plant of the genus Kalanchoe native to Madagascar. A few of the…

FOTD: 11/23/2022 – Plumeria
Today’s Walking Squares selection is putting the spotlight on Plumeria and the Atkinson Plumeria Farm. The Atkinson’s have been growing and selling plumeria in San Diego’s East County since 1997. They also offer classes, consultation services, and sales throughout the year. Stacy also uses the various Plumeria to make leis and to teach others how…
